Dog Home Euthanasia

We know how hard this time is for you and we want to make it as stress free as possible. We know the fear of the unknown can cause worry so we want to explain what happens clearly.

When we have confirmed a visit time, we come to your home in our home clothes which don't smell of 'the vet'. We introduce ourselves and once everyone is comfortable with us being there, we administer the first injection.

This injection goes under the skin, on the top of the neck, where a vaccination might go. We recommend at this point giving your dog a treat or a little scratch around the ears to distract them.

It contains pain releif and relaxant which will help your dog feel comforted by the sounds and smells around. Your calm, soothing voice and demenour will allow your dog to fall into a sleep while you are holding and soothing them. We move back but stay present so you don't feel worried.

Once in that deep sleep we then give the last injection, which will go into the leg vein.

We often suggest to focus on your lovely pet not on what we are doing to make the last moments really connected.

Afterwards, when we have confirmed your dog has passed, we will leave you to say goodbye without us being there and can wait outside.

Once you are ready, we will come in with a bed and blankets to wrap thm up and take them straight to our crematorium if you wish for cremation.

We offer pawprint and hair clips if you would like this too, so just let us know.
